The World Social Work Day takes place on the 15th March 2022. The theme: ´Co-building a New Eco-Social World: Leaving No One Behind´ coincides with the theme of the people´s summit that will take place on the 29th June to the 2nd July.

The theme presents a vision and action plan to create new global values, policies and practices that develop trust, security and confidence for all people and the sustainability of the planet.

Remaking Social Work for The New Era

Malaysian Association of Social Workers (MASW) organized P.C. Sushama Lecture Series 2 with the focus on “Remaking Social Work for The New Era” via Zoom.  MASW is proud to share that the esteemed speaker for the talk will be Professor Dr. Tan Ngoh Tiong.

The lecture provide the framework for the future of social work practice that focuses on social transformation towards a greener, fairer, and more technological world as well as the social work effectiveness in responding to worldwide social-economic and societal disruptions in terms of conflict, refugees, migration, pandemic and natural disasters and the impending social reset

THE WAY FORWARD FOR SOCIAL WORK: LESSONS LEARN FROM THE GLOBAL TRENDS

The Malaysian Association of Social Workers (MASW) in collaboration with the Faculty of Arts and Social Sciences, Universiti Malaya (UM) has organized a hybrid public lecture entitled ‘The Way Forward for Social Work – Lessons from The Global Trends’. The public talk was delivered by Dr Rory Truell, IFSW Secretary-General and this program is aimed to provide a platform for sharing information about the direction of the social work profession from the perspective of current global developments with the Malaysian social work community, as well as interacting and exchanging ideas with Dr. Rory Truell to advance the social work profession.
